Cov txheej txheem:

Tej thaj chaw deb Loj Loj Matrix Artnet Raspberry Pi: 8 Cov Kauj Ruam (nrog Duab)
Tej thaj chaw deb Loj Loj Matrix Artnet Raspberry Pi: 8 Cov Kauj Ruam (nrog Duab)

Video: Tej thaj chaw deb Loj Loj Matrix Artnet Raspberry Pi: 8 Cov Kauj Ruam (nrog Duab)

Video: Tej thaj chaw deb Loj Loj Matrix Artnet Raspberry Pi: 8 Cov Kauj Ruam (nrog Duab)
Video: Tsis Deev Koj Thiaj Tsis Seev BY Aka 2024, Lub Xya hli ntuj
Anonim
Image
Image
Tej thaj chaw deb Loj Led Matrix Artnet Raspberry Pi
Tej thaj chaw deb Loj Led Matrix Artnet Raspberry Pi

Peb xav ua qhov loj wifi coj matrix. Txoj haujlwm siv 200 WS2801 coj, lub zog loj loj zoo li no LEDNexus 5V 40A 200 W thiab Raspberry Pi zoo li "lub hlwb" ntawm kev ua yeeb yam.

Peb pib ua cov qauv ntoo ntawm matrix thiab tom qab peb mus ua lub paj hlwb. Raspberry Pi nrog OLA rau Raspberry Pi. Tom qab qhov no koj tuaj yeem ua haujlwm ntawm koj tus lej hauv hom wifi. Sab hauv LAN koj tuaj yeem siv lub khoos phis tawj xa mus rau Raspberry Pi cov duab, cov ntawv thiab cov duab rau cov lej coj.

Koj tuaj yeem yuav 200 pcs ntawm W2801 los ntawm Amazon qhov chaw, kuj koj tuaj yeem yuav Raspberry Pi 3, lossis mini Raspberrry Pi ZERO.

Kauj Ruam 1: Txiav daim

Txiav tej daim
Txiav tej daim
Txiav tej daim
Txiav tej daim
Txiav tej daim
Txiav tej daim
Txiav tej daim
Txiav tej daim

Txhawm rau ua tus qauv ntawm cov lej, kuv tau siv ob lub rooj ntoo 1 mt x 1 mt. Kuv tau txiav tus ncej, thiab tom qab kuv tau txiav cov faib. Txhawm rau tsim cov qauv xaj kuv xav txog kev tso lub LED txhua 10 cm yog li kuv tau txais 10 LEDs ib sab. Tag nrho saum npoo ntawm txhua qhov sib piv los ntawm 1 mt x mt 1 tau npog nrog 100 LEDs hauv tag nrho ob daim ntawv teev npe muaj 200 LEDs txhua. Txhua kab sib cais los ntawm lwm qhov, thiab tseem tuaj yeem siv tus kheej. Matrices, thaum tso, haum rau lawv tus kheej, tsim kom muaj lub cev muaj zog.

Kauj Ruam 2: Sib Sau Cov Qauv

Sib Sau Cov Qauv
Sib Sau Cov Qauv
Sib Sau Cov Qauv
Sib Sau Cov Qauv
Sib Sau Cov Qauv
Sib Sau Cov Qauv

Los ntawm kev ua txhua tus qauv Kuv tau siv cov yas. Tag nrho cov faib faib rau hauv nws ob sab kom haum sab hauv. Cov qauv no yog lub teeb heev thiab muaj zog.

Kuv tau siv lub roj teeb hnyav thiab ntau txoj hlua rau tuav ua ke cov qauv ruaj khov.

Kauj Ruam 3: Qhov

Qhov
Qhov
Qhov
Qhov

Thaum cov txheej txheem npaj tiav koj tuaj yeem ua lub qhov. Tsuas yog 200 qhov rau tag nrho txoj haujlwm:-) Lub qhov ua tau zoo nyob hauv nruab nrab. Kuv lub tswv yim yog siv daim npog ntsej muag rau nruab nrab lub qhov.

Kauj Ruam 4: Xim Sab Hauv Tus Qauv

Xim Sab Hauv Tus Qauv
Xim Sab Hauv Tus Qauv
Xim Sab Hauv Tus Qauv
Xim Sab Hauv Tus Qauv
Xim Sab Hauv Tus Qauv
Xim Sab Hauv Tus Qauv
Xim Sab Hauv Tus Qauv
Xim Sab Hauv Tus Qauv

Yog tias koj xav tau qhov txiaj ntsig zoo, koj tuaj yeem pleev xim sab hauv ntawm cov qauv. Cov xim yog dawb vim hais tias dawb cuam tshuam tag nrho cov xim. Thiab thaum cov coj ci xim qhov no cuam tshuam txog cov qauv hauv kev coj rov qab.

Tom qab kuv thov plexiglass opaline los npog cov qauv zoo li hauv daim duab.

Kauj Ruam 5: WS2801 Coj Sawb

WS2801 Coj Sawb
WS2801 Coj Sawb

Koj tuaj yeem siv ws2801 coj sawb. Qhov no yog ib txoj hlua coj uas muaj sab hauv txhua tus coj microprocessor rau tswj RGB coj. Cov hlua no muaj 4 txoj hlua: GND VCC DATA CLOCK. Txhua tus coj siv 0, 06A ntawm 5 Volts. Kev noj ntawm txhua tus coj yog 0, 3W. Txwv tsis pub 200 leds siv 60W ntawm tam sim no. Vim li no yog qhov tseem ceeb tshaj plaws siv lub qhov hluav taws xob thib ob los ntawm kev noj cov leds. Kuv siv lub zog 50W 5V. Kuv cov lus qhia yog ntxiv 1000 mF condensator ua ntej txuas mus rau leds. Yog tias koj siv ntau dua ib txoj hlua, kuv cov lus qhia yog txhawm rau txuas cov zaub mov noj mus rau txhua qhov kab txaij.

Kauj Ruam 6: Lub Hlwb: Raspberry Pi

Lub Hlwb: Raspberry Pi
Lub Hlwb: Raspberry Pi

Raspberry Pi yog lub paj hlwb ntawm peb coj matrix. Koj tuaj yeem siv Raspbian distro los tswj cov coj. Lub distro yog OLA. Koj tuaj yeem rub tawm qhov kawg ntawm OLA los ntawm: https://dl.openlighting.org thiab teeb duab ntawm SD. Tom qab koj tuaj yeem pib Raspberry Pi thiab txuas qhov no mus rau LAN.

Koj tuaj yeem qhib nplooj ntawv teeb tsa los ntawm qhov browser ntawm koj lub computer. Kev nkag tau yooj yim. Mus rau IP ntawm koj li Raspberry Pi. Ib yam zoo li https://192.168.x.x. Yog tias koj saib OLA teeb nplooj ntawv, txhua yam zoo. Tam sim no koj hloov kho ola-spi.conf. Rau qhov haujlwm no los ntawm cov lej hauv qab: sudo nano /var/lib/ola/conf/ola-spi.conf Ntxig qhov teeb tsa raug. Ua raws cov lus qhia ntawm:

Txuag cov ntawv, dua li rov pib dua lub system. Tus lej: sudo reboot. Tom qab ntawm nplooj ntawv teeb tsa ntawm OLA hauv 192.168.x.x browser nplooj ntawv, xaiv ArtNet rau kev tawm tswv yim thiab SPI rau cov zis. Tam sim no ntawm koj lub khoos phis tawj koj tuaj yeem siv Glediator lossis Jinx! Yog tias koj siv OSX koj tuaj yeem xaiv tsuas yog Glediator. Hloov chaw yog tias koj siv Windows system koj tuaj yeem siv Glediator thiab tseem Jinx! Koj tuaj yeem rub tawm Glediator los ntawm qhov txuas no (https://www.solderlab.de/index.php/software/glediator) Thiab koj tuaj yeem rub tau Jinx! los ntawm qhov txuas no (https://www.live-leds.de/)

Tam sim no koj tuaj yeem txuas Raspberry Pi mus rau kev coj ua matrix.

PIN "cov ntaub ntawv" ntawm LEDs yuav tsum txuas nrog GPIO 10 (MOSI).

Tus PIN "moos" ntawm LEDs yuav tsum txuas nrog GPIO 11 (SCKL)

Hauv av "GND" ntawm LED (xiav) yuav tsum txuas nrog GPIO rau hauv av

Kauj Ruam 7: Kev npaj thiab xeem

Alimentation thiab Test
Alimentation thiab Test
Alimentation thiab Test
Alimentation thiab Test
Alimentation thiab Test
Alimentation thiab Test

Kuv tau sim cov lej nrog Arduino UNO thiab Adafruit Library. Rau qhov kev xeem kuv pom zoo kom siv cov tshuaj no cais tawm lwm cov ntsiab lus (Raspbian, LAN, raws tu qauv thiab lwm yam).

Kauj Ruam 8: Qhov Kawg

Matrix yog txaus. Kuv tuaj yeem siv cov lej no rau cov ntawv xov xwm, ua yeeb yaj kiab lossis ua yeeb yaj kiab nyob zoo li Kev Ua lossis zoo sib xws. Tus nqi tag nrho ntawm txoj haujlwm rau cov ntaub ntawv yog 250 $. Txoj kev daws teeb meem zoo tshaj plaws yog Raspberry Pi zoo li lub hlwb, vim tias koj tuaj yeem siv tus qauv ntsuas los ntawm lwm qhov chaw, thiab koj tuaj yeem saib cov duab ua yeeb yam. Zoo heev!

Pom zoo: